read moreTres Amigos presents a vibrant fusion of Moroccan and Spanish cuisine in Eastbourne, captivating diners with its friendly atmosphere and attentive service. Guests rave about the delicious tapas and generous portions, with standout dishes like calamari and seabass receiving high praise. While the restaurant occasionally faces issues with reservations and unexpected closures, those who manage to dine here often describe it as a hidden gem, complete with complimentary olives and thoughtful touches. With a diverse menu that caters to various dietary preferences, Tres Amigos is a must-visit for food lovers seeking authentic flavors and warm hospitality.
